Transaction c859b63c71f08f8cb5a2c669bf594fed551c98a7cabf2ccbdc4aaa7214ea7031

1 Input
2 Outputs
  • c859b63c71f08f8cb5a2c669bf594fed551c98a7cabf2ccbdc4aaa7214ea7031:0
  • value  1110847772
    address  3CrmB3cs7uZCHwCtEAoJKpFZ2uwkWRmp3P
  • c859b63c71f08f8cb5a2c669bf594fed551c98a7cabf2ccbdc4aaa7214ea7031:1
  • value  882315
    address  1JHUnqHW9Nodz8bKpD2Tb3LeXYa1vzkMzx